If you want to bind volumes outside of Docker, this is what you need to do.

There was a huge permission and volume mapping problem. I mention github issues that helped me here.

I hope that will help noobs and insecure people like me.


cd /srv/path/Files
git clone https://github.com/mediacms-io/mediacms
cd /srv/path/Files/mediacms
mkdir postgres_data \
&& chmod -R 755 postgres_data
nano docker-compose.yaml
version: "3"

services:
  redis:
    image: "redis:alpine"
    restart: always
    healthcheck:
      test: ["CMD", "redis-cli","ping"]
      interval: 30s
      timeout: 10s
      retries: 3

  migrations:
    image: mediacms/mediacms:latest
    volumes:
      - /srv/path/Files/mediacms/deploy:/home/mediacms.io/mediacms/deploy
      - /srv/path/Files/mediacms/logs:/home/mediacms.io/mediacms/logs
      - /srv/path/Files/mediacms/media_files:/home/mediacms.io/mediacms/media_files
      - /srv/path/Files/mediacms/cms/settings.py:/home/mediacms.io/mediacms/cms/settings.py
    environment:
      ENABLE_UWSGI: 'no'
      ENABLE_NGINX: 'no'
      ENABLE_CELERY_SHORT: 'no'
      ENABLE_CELERY_LONG: 'no'
      ENABLE_CELERY_BEAT: 'no'
      ADMIN_USER: 'admin'
      ADMIN_EMAIL: 'admin@localhost'
      ADMIN_PASSWORD: 'complicatedpassword'
    restart: on-failure
    depends_on:
      redis:
        condition: service_healthy
  web:
    image: mediacms/mediacms:latest
    deploy:
      replicas: 1
    ports:
      - "8870:80" #whatever:80
    volumes:
      - /srv/path/Files/mediacms/deploy:/home/mediacms.io/mediacms/deploy
      - /srv/path/Files/mediacms/logs:/home/mediacms.io/mediacms/logs
      - /srv/path/Files/mediacms/media_files:/home/mediacms.io/mediacms/media_files
      - /srv/path/Files/mediacms/cms/settings.py:/home/mediacms.io/mediacms/cms/settings.py
    environment:
#      ENABLE_UWSGI: 'no' #keep commented
      ENABLE_CELERY_BEAT: 'no'
      ENABLE_CELERY_SHORT: 'no'
      ENABLE_CELERY_LONG: 'no'
      ENABLE_MIGRATIONS: 'no'
      
  db:
    image: postgres:15.2-alpine
    volumes:
      - /srv/path/Files/mediacms/postgres_data:/var/lib/postgresql/data/
    restart: always
    environment:
      POSTGRES_USER: mediacms
      POSTGRES_PASSWORD: mediacms
      POSTGRES_DB: mediacms
      TZ: Europe/Paris
    healthcheck:
      test: ["CMD-SHELL", "pg_isready", "--host=db", "--dbname=$POSTGRES_DB", "--username=$POSTGRES_USER"]
      interval: 30s
      timeout: 10s
      retries: 5

  celery_beat:
    image: mediacms/mediacms:latest
    volumes:
      - /srv/path/Files/mediacms/deploy:/home/mediacms.io/mediacms/deploy
      - /srv/path/Files/mediacms/logs:/home/mediacms.io/mediacms/logs
      - /srv/path/Files/mediacms/media_files:/home/mediacms.io/mediacms/media_files
      - /srv/path/Files/mediacms/cms/settings.py:/home/mediacms.io/mediacms/cms/settings.py
    environment:
      ENABLE_UWSGI: 'no'
      ENABLE_NGINX: 'no'
      ENABLE_CELERY_SHORT: 'no'
      ENABLE_CELERY_LONG: 'no'
      ENABLE_MIGRATIONS: 'no'

  celery_worker:
    image: mediacms/mediacms:latest
    deploy:
      replicas: 1
    volumes:
      - /srv/path/Files/mediacms/deploy:/home/mediacms.io/mediacms/deploy
      - /srv/path/Files/mediacms/logs:/home/mediacms.io/mediacms/logs
      - /srv/path/Files/mediacms/media_files:/home/mediacms.io/mediacms/media_files
      - /srv/path/Files/mediacms/cms/settings.py:/home/mediacms.io/mediacms/cms/settings.py
    environment:
      ENABLE_UWSGI: 'no'
      ENABLE_NGINX: 'no'
      ENABLE_CELERY_BEAT: 'no'
      ENABLE_MIGRATIONS: 'no'
    depends_on:
      - migrations
docker-compose up -d

CSS will probably be missing because reasons, so bash into web container

docker exec -it mediacms_web_1 /bin/bash

Then

python manage.py collectstatic

No need to reboot
